The European Airpol Network conducted First Responder training at the American CYCLOPS Training Center in Larnaca.
According to the Cyprus Police, the training aimed at the better cooperation between First Responder services at airports so as to counter any terrorist attack or various other illegal actions.
The training was attended by members of the Cyprus Police and other services, including the Ambulance Service.

As stated by the Ministry of Foreign Affairs, the “Cyprus Center for Land, Open-seas and Port Security” (CYCLOPS) is a training center owned by the Republic of Cyprus, based in Larnaca. The project was implemented in close cooperation with the government of the United States of America, based on a Memorandum of Understanding signed on September 12, 2020 between the Republic of Cyprus and the United States of America.
The financing for the construction and equipment of the CYCLOPS Training Center was undertaken by the Export Control and Related Border Security (EXBS) program of the US State Department, while the Republic of Cyprus provided the land exploited for its construction. With the completion of the construction works on February 28, 2022, the Center came under the ownership of the Republic of Cyprus through the Ministry of Foreign Affairs, which is also responsible for its operation. CYCLOPS is based in Larnaca and was inaugurated on April 6, 2022.
The CYCLOPS training center hosts various training activities in the field of security with the participation of international bodies, including the UNODC office for combating crime at sea and AIRPOL, which aims to strengthen overall security at EU airports and in the civil aviation sector.
